Definition and Scope:
Women's pumps are a type of shoe that is characterized by a closed back, a low-cut front, and a high heel. They are typically designed to be worn by women and are considered a classic and versatile shoe style. Pumps are known for their elegant and sophisticated look. They are often made of various materials such as leather, suede, patent leather, or fabric, and come in a wide range of colors and patterns. The heel heights can vary, ranging from kitten heels (around 1 to 2 inches) to stiletto heels (typically 4 to 6 inches or higher). The defining feature of pumps is their closed back, which covers the heel and provides support to the foot. The low-cut front exposes the top of the foot, giving a feminine and stylish appearance. Pumps usually have a pointed or rounded toe shape, although there are variations with peep toes or other toe designs.
Women's pumps are a popular choice for various occasions, including formal events, professional settings, parties, or even everyday wear. They can be paired with dresses, skirts, trousers, or jeans, depending on the desired look and level of formality. Pumps offer versatility, as they can easily transition from daytime to evening wear, and they are often favoured for their ability to elevate an outfit and add a touch of sophistication.

The global Women’s Pumps market size is projected to reach US$ 23501.18 Million by 2029 from US$ 18035.10 million in 2022 at a CAGR of 3.98% during 2023-2029. Inclusivity in size and width is Women’s Pumps Market core driver of development. This driver stems from the recognition that women come in diverse body types and have various foot shapes and sizes. In the past, the footwear industry often had limited size ranges and standard width options, leading to a lack of options for many women, especially those with non-standard foot shapes or larger sizes. To address the need for inclusivity, forward-thinking brands in the women's pumps market are actively expanding their size ranges to accommodate a broader spectrum of foot sizes. Segment by Type, the Women’s Pumps can be split into Classic Pumps, Stiletto Pumps, Kitten Heel Pumps, Platform Pumps, Peep Toe Pumps, Slingback Pumps, Wedge Pumps, etc. In 2022, the Classic Pumps segment already holds the highest market share at 38.56%. At the same time, the Slingback Pumps segment will expand at a highest CAGR of 5.15% during the forecast period. The dominance of the Classic Pumps segment in the women's pumps market can be attributed to its timeless design, versatility, professional appeal, and status as a wardrobe staple. These factors combine to create a strong market demand and contribute to the segment's high market share. Slingback pumps offer a modern twist on the classic pump style. They retain the elegance and sophistication of traditional pumps while introducing a unique and contemporary element with their exposed heel and ankle strap design. Slingback pumps are often associated with a fashion-forward and trendy aesthetic. Consumers who want to stay updated with the latest styles may gravitate towards this segment. The segment's ability to cater to evolving fashion preferences, diverse age groups, and different occasions contributes to its high projected CAGR.
According to the application field, the Women’s Pumps market can be split into directly managed stores, own space in retail stores, e-commerce, etc. The E-Commerce segment brings 45.53% of the market revenue and will expand at a CAGR of 6.10% during the forecast period. On basis of geography, the Women’s Pumps market is segmented into North America, Europe, Asia-Pacific, South America, Middle East and Africa, etc. Currently, the Asia-Pacific market contributes more than 35% of the revenue, and its market size will expand at the highest growth rate during the forecast period. The Asia-Pacific region has been experiencing significant economic growth, leading to an expanding middle class with increasing disposable income. As more consumers in this region can afford luxury and fashion products, the demand for women's pumps is on the rise. With greater exposure to global fashion trends through social media, online platforms, and international media, consumers in the Asia-Pacific region are becoming more fashion-conscious and seeking stylish footwear options. The popularity of Korean and Japanese pop culture has a substantial influence on fashion trends in the Asia-Pacific region. This includes footwear choices like women's pumps that align with the stylish aesthetics of these cultures. E-commerce has witnessed explosive growth in the Asia-Pacific region, making it easier for consumers to access a wide range of products, including women's pumps, from various brands and countries. The Asia-Pacific market's dominant revenue contribution and high growth rate in the women's pumps market can be attributed to economic growth, changing lifestyles, fashion-conscious consumers, cultural events, the influence of celebrities and pop culture, and the flourishing e-commerce landscape. These factors collectively create a favorable environment for the sustained expansion of the market in the region.
According to our calculations, in 2022, the global Women’s Pumps market's market concentration indicators CR5 and HHI were 12.20% and 3.31%, respectively. This means that the market concentration of women’s pumps market is very low, and manufacturers are in very fierce competition.
